Another 335d Touring - For Sale
'14 F31 335d Xdrive Touring Msport+
Melbourne Red with Venetian Beige interior Performance Black Grills 78,000 Miles Spec: MSport+ (Big Brake kit, 19" Alloys, HK Audio) Pro Nav w/ RTTI till Nov '18 Adaptive Headlights + Visibility Pack Electric Memory Seats Rear View Cam + Auto Parking Brushed Alu + Black Gloss trim Privacy Glass MPerformance 405M Black 18" Winter Alloys Mods: DMS ECU Remap (380hp/700nm) Bird's B3x Suspension: Eilbach Springs, Custom Valved Bilstein Dampers Maintenance: Full BMW Service History Major Service in May '18 / 77k New OEM Pads, Zimmermann Discs in May '18 / 77k Rear Michelin PS4S fitted May '18 / 77k Front Michelin PSS with 5mm tread MOT till June 2019 The car spent the first 3 years mostly covering motorway miles, with weekend family duties. Since then it spent more time as a local school run hack, recently cleaned up and reinstated as my ‘daily’. The exterior is showing a little more wear; the paint was originally protected with a Gtechniq detail but could do with being re-done. There is minor stone chipping in the usual places, and few minor marks on the doors from the school run etc (no dents). There is a minor scrape on the rear arch that would need paint repair (see pic). Both sets of alloys are curbed along the rim and would benefit from a refurb - example pic of each included. It came with Adaptive Suspension but after test-driving the Bird’s B3x demo car I was sold on what I think the ‘Msport+’ car should have come with OEM. The Adaptive has been coded out. It sits 10mm Front/ 15mm Rear lower, vastly improves road feel and turn-in and gives the car a neutral balance with power-induced oversteer available in Msp+. The DMS map compliments the improved handling characteristics, I have their less aggressive map fitted but it still pulls hard up top with power notably increasing till >5000rpm. Asking £17,500.
